Letter: Why Shen Yun is banned from Calgary Jube is not rocket science
Did the Calgary Herald forget to mention in their May 24 article entitled "Minister denies pressure from China" that Shen Yun has been the target of a string of sabotage attempts from Beijing's long arm to cancel Shen Yun shows in major cities around the globe--and particularly in 2009 and 2008 when the Chinese Consulate blocked Calgary Shen Yun sponsors (CBC). It is utterly outrageous to learn that this dance company got barred from Calgary and Edmonton Jubes simply for speaking out. Seriously, how can we ignore the elephant in the room when it comes to Shen Yun? It's a well known secrete that those expat artists are on the Chinese regime most hated hit list. The poor treatment from the Jube and their unwillingness to openly resolve the issues at hand after 3 years deserved to hit the media. The overzealous response alone from the Alberta Minister of Culture is proof enough that something unusual is at play here and denial is not going to cut it. Let's not get fooled again! Events in China Outpacing Canadian MPs, Says Anders
“I think a lot of people get bought into the checkbook diplomacy. I think that China is very good at taking people over to China and Shanghai and giving them a stay at a five-star hotel, and introducing them to people that speak excellent English and take them out for a night on the town, and stroke their egos and offer them business deals.”
The problem is a lot of our people are naïve. MP Rob Anders.
Some MPs The Epoch Times has spoken to have been uncomfortable
talking about the unfolding events on the record; but few seem to have
followed events closely. Some MPs who are closely involved in China seem
relatively unaware of the abuses by the regime.“The problem is a lot of our people are naive,” said Anders.
MPs offered great business deals that keep paying after they put up a bit of money don’t see themselves as bought, said Anders. Other officials approached by a woman a third their age don’t want to recognize that they are being offered favours, he said.
“They don’t want to see that for what it is. … They’re too proud to admit that they’ve been taken.”
“That is the best way to judge the regime—by their actions, not by the words of the leaders in one-on-one meetings.”

Coup in Beijing, Says Chinese Internet Rumor Mill
According to the message that went viral on China’s Internet, a military force with unknown designation quickly occupied many important places in Zhongnanhai, the Chinese leadership compound in Beijing, and Beijing in the early morning of March 20, with the cooperation of Beijing armed police.
The troops entered Beijing to “get and protect Bo Xilai,” according to the message.
A mainland Chinese reader has told The Epoch Times that a military coup has taken place in Beijing.
It is still unknown who, if anyone, has been arrested.
The message claims Zhou Yongkang first used armed police force in an attempt to arrest Hu and Wen. However, Hu and Wen had been prepared and Zhou’s coup was subdued, though rumors of Hu and Wen being arrested had been spread earlier.
